Internal Audit
Internal audit is the audit mechanism that determines whether public expenditure has been used economically, effectively and efficiently, and prevents errors and deficiencies from arising, under Article 63 of the Public Financial Management and Control Law No. 5018. Internal audit is carried out both by the internal auditors referred to in Law No. 5018 and by the inspection and preliminary examination units appointed under contracting authorities' own internal legislation. As internal audit alone is not sufficient, it must be combined with external audit to ensure transparency.
